Summary

Authenticated SQL Injection via nested eager-loading criteria

Description

A non-admin, low-privileged Control Panel user (whose permission set is limited to the single baseline permission accessCp) can perform blind SQL injection against the element-index endpoint (element-indexes/get-elements and siblings), gaining arbitrary read access to the database.

This breaks Craft’s own privilege-separation model: a confined “editor/author” account (which is normally restricted to a handful of sections/fields) escalates to full database read access, which in practice is equivalent to admin-level information disclosure and serves as a stepping stone to full account takeover.

Precondition: Craft 5.10.12, Team or Pro edition (multi-user support), at least one existing non-admin account with the baseline accessCp permission, and at least one entry with an author. No non-default configuration is required.

Impact

This vulnerability allows any low-privileged authenticated Control Panel user to read the application database via blind SQL injection.
